Buddy Matthews is possibly dealing with an injury.
AEW Grand Slam: Australia featured a AEW Continental Championship bout between Buddy Matthews and Kazuchika Okada. During his entrance, Matthews appeared to hurt his ankle, but the match still went on as planned.
Matthews responded in a seemingly sarcastic fashion after the show, saying in a now-deleted tweet that he wouldn't have "destroyed his ankle" if it wasn't for AEW's small ring. Matthews later followed up by posting a photo of a troll, likely indicating his sarcasm.
On Monday, February 17, Rhea Ripley took to social media to share a number of photos with Matthews, as the couple is currently on their honeymoon. In one photo, Matthews is seen using one crutch. In the other photos, Matthews does not have a crutch.
Ripley captioned the post with a statement that alludes to Matthews rolling his ankle, "Ain’t no Roly-Poly ankles gonna keep us down! Let the honeymoon commence!"
